DODGE NEON vs GMC SIERRA

Side-by-side comparison of the DODGE NEON and GMC SIERRA drawn from the NHTSA consumer-complaint database, defect investigations, recall history, and NCAP crash-test ratings.

According to the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A), more than 2,000,000 consumer complaints have been filed against U.S. vehicles (2,054,142 as of August 2026). This is a head-to-head safety comparison between the DODGE NEON (1993–2005) and the GMC SIERRA (1976–2017), drawn from that federal complaint and recall record; see our methodology for how the figures are compiled.

The DODGE NEON (1993–2005, 13 model years) carries 4,954 NHTSA consumer complaints and 13 safety recalls, while the GMC SIERRA (1976–2017, 35 model years) carries 4,896 complaints and 51 recalls. Severity indicators for the pair split as follows: 657 vs 354 crashes, 158 vs 84 fires, and 71 vs 28 reported fatalities.

Raw complaint counts favor whichever nameplate has fewer vehicles on the road, so the cleaner lens is components: which specific part families concentrate each model's filings? For the DODGE NEON, the leading complaint category is engine and engine cooling:engine (842 filings), followed by air bags:frontal and engine and engine cooling:engine:gasoline. For the GMC SIERRA, it is service brakes, hydraulic:antilock/traction control/electronic limited slip (618), ahead of service brakes and visibility:windshield wiper/washer:motor. When the two vehicles cluster around the same component, the problem is likely a shared supplier or a shared federal standard under stress; when they diverge, each nameplate has its own defect signature independent of the other.

Average NCAP crash-test scores are not uniformly available for both nameplates in this dataset, which typically means one or both pre-date the 2011 rating methodology refresh. Frequently Asked Questions

Which is safer, DODGE NEON or GMC SIERRA?
DODGE NEON has 4,954 total NHTSA complaints with 657 crashes, while GMC SIERRA has 4,896 complaints with 354 crashes. Review individual model years for specific safety ratings.
How many recalls does DODGE NEON have compared to GMC SIERRA?
DODGE NEON has 13 recalls across 13 model years, while GMC SIERRA has 51 recalls across 35 model years.
What are the most common problems with DODGE NEON?
The most commonly reported issues for DODGE NEON are: 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ING:ENGINE (842 complaints), AIR BAGS:FRONTAL (305 complaints), 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ING:ENGINE:GASOLINE (276 complaints), POWER TRAIN:A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ION (170 complaints), UNKNOWN OR OTHER (151 complaints).
What are the most common problems with GMC SIERRA?
The most commonly reported issues for GMC SIERRA are: SERVICE BRAKES, HYDRAULIC:ANTILOCK/TRACTION CONTROL/ELECTRONIC LIMITED SLIP (618 complaints), SERVICE BRAKES (304 complaints), VISIBILITY:WINDSHIELD WIPER/WASHER:MOTOR (253 complaints), VISIBILITY:WINDSHIELD WIPER/WASHER (164 complaints), SERVICE BRAKES, HYDRAULIC (159 complaints).
